Skip to main content

Minimal cartesian genetic programming for symbolic regression.

Project description

cartesian: is a lightweight implementation of Cartesian genetic programming with symbolic regression in mind.

image0 image1 PyPI DOI Documentation Status Code style: black


It is meant to be used in conjunction with deap or glyph.

The basic components are provided:
  • data structure

  • 1+4 Algorithm

  • symbolic, ephemeral random and structure-based constants

Installation

cartesian is available on PyPI

pip install cartesian

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

cartesian-0.1.10.tar.gz (18.0 kB view details)

Uploaded Source

Built Distribution

cartesian-0.1.10-py3-none-any.whl (11.1 kB view details)

Uploaded Python 3

File details

Details for the file cartesian-0.1.10.tar.gz.

File metadata

  • Download URL: cartesian-0.1.10.tar.gz
  • Upload date:
  • Size: 18.0 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/1.11.0 pkginfo/1.4.2 requests/2.19.1 setuptools/40.2.0 requests-toolbelt/0.8.0 tqdm/4.26.0 CPython/3.6.3

File hashes

Hashes for cartesian-0.1.10.tar.gz
Algorithm Hash digest
SHA256 5897c8ba9173b84a42d93b0deb607cc0a2b8236733165104159535cd026b103d
MD5 490a97bb5b43c355897d8503abf411ea
BLAKE2b-256 57b4b61330350b8bdf287c6b765b73da79394f24f071fb328281686fa6de0914

See more details on using hashes here.

File details

Details for the file cartesian-0.1.10-py3-none-any.whl.

File metadata

  • Download URL: cartesian-0.1.10-py3-none-any.whl
  • Upload date:
  • Size: 11.1 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/1.11.0 pkginfo/1.4.2 requests/2.19.1 setuptools/40.2.0 requests-toolbelt/0.8.0 tqdm/4.26.0 CPython/3.6.3

File hashes

Hashes for cartesian-0.1.10-py3-none-any.whl
Algorithm Hash digest
SHA256 fa244a239c132daaf5971588ff73682d366aeacd1e35a748262c4121926d15b8
MD5 169ac07dbb5ea8bf535eb318e93bae7c
BLAKE2b-256 94dbcd4f4e7c10a516d952edda8c0b41266dc8916cb2e24f58a236b042709b54

See more details on using hashes here.

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page